decibel
countable noun: A decibel is a unit of measurement which is used to indicate how loud a sound is. decibel in American English a numerical expression of the relative loudness of a sound: the difference in decibels between two sounds is ten times the common logarithm of the ratio of their power levels noun: a unit used to express the intensity of a sound wave, equal to 20 times the common logarithm of the ratio of the pressure produced by the sound wave to a reference pressure, usually 0.0002 microbar decibel in British English noun: a unit for comparing two currents, voltages, or power levels, equal to one tenth of a bel decibel in Electrical Engineering noun: A decibel is a method for specifying the ratio of two signals. |
